**The team you'll be part of**
As Nokia's growth engine, we create value for communication service providers and enterprise customers by leading the transition to cloud-native software and as-a-service delivery models. Our inclusive team of dreamers, doers and disruptors push the limits from impossible to possible.
Mobile Network Insights is a portfolio of use cases and products providing rich big data analytics capabilities for mobile communications service providers globally. Our capabilities are ranging from Network Element EDGE analytics to advanced on-prem analytics and AI&ML solutions backed by managed public cloud alike services.
In Mobile Network Insights Engineering we innovate and deliver the core use cases and value for MNI customer solutions. We are the experts and partners for our customers in multi vendor network data at the network element level, and our solutions are fully cloud native to be customized and deployed according to varying customer needs.
**What you will learn and contribute to**
Are you passionate in solving problems and deliver value to customers?
As part of our team, you will:
- Build and lead a technical customer engagement team to work with support and services teams, and customers, to ensure value of MNI products is fully harnessed over the life cycle.
- Be a Thought Leader for your team members in customer value creation, agile practises, and cloud native / public cloud technology domains close to your personal sources of inspiration.
- Be a People Leader and Manager for a team of technical specialists and SW developers.
- Be a professional learning and career coach to your team members to grow to their full potential. Nurture talent pipeline and create opportunities for growth for you people.
- Manage supplier partnerships to complement add up to team capabilities where needed.
- Plan, develop and deploy capabilities to deliver engineering projects.
**Your skills and experience**
You have:
- A proven track record of building and leading teams of senior technical talent.
- Expertise and vision on cloud native and public cloud services technology domains.
- Passion to work with people and for people to support their professional growth.
- Expertise in developing and delivering SW based value for complex customer solutions.
It would be nice if you also had:
- Expertise on mobile networks and telecommunications technology domains.
- Expertise on one or more big data analytics technology domains.
- Open mind in listening and collecting feedback from your stakeholders.
- A masters /bachelor’s degree in university or in applied sciences.
